- Tunnel Mountain - Park just ahead for the Tunnel Mountain Trail, a moderate 3-mile hike leading to the summit of Banff’s smallest mountain.
- Bow River - Bow River is the lifeline of this area. Before colonization, the First Nations people drank from it, hunted along its banks, and even made bows from the reeds growing beside the river!
- Hoodoos Viewpoint - Wondering what a hoodoo is? Great question! A hoodoo is a tall, thin spire of rock formed by erosion.
- Johnson Lake - This lake is a local favorite and is usually less crowded than other spots. There’s an easy walking trail that circles the lake, too.
- Lake Minnewanka - For thousands of years, people have gathered at its shores for hunting and camping.
- Mount Norquay Lookout - This location offers a postcard-perfect panoramic view of the Bow Valley, the Canadian Rockies, and the town of Banff! Look for the parking area on your right if you wish to stop.
- Bow Falls Viewpoint - Bow Falls Viewpoint provides a magnificent view of a cascading waterfall. If you’re keen to get closer to the Falls, there’s a 1.7-mile trail that takes about 45 minutes to complete.
- Banff National Park - Situated in the heart of the Canadian Rockies, Banff National Park captivates with its pristine alpine landscapes, turquoise lakes, and rugged mountain peaks, offering a paradise for outdoor adventurers and nature lovers alike.
